Definition of parchments:

(n) : Material, made from the polished skin of a calf, sheep, goat or other animal, used like paper for writing.
(n) : A document made on such material.
(n) : A diploma (traditionally written on parchment).
(n) : Stiff paper imitating that material.
(n) : The creamy to tanned color of parchment.
(n) : The envelope of the coffee grains, inside the pulp.
